If you want to do something fun for Labor Day and just haven't found anything yet, may I suggest the Louisiana Shrimp & Petroleum Festival in Morgan City?

Usually, festivals that have been around for over 70 years kind of know what they're doing by now.

This festival is truly a family-friendly event. There's a children's village, tons of arts and crafts, great food and fantastic live music.

While you're there you can also take a guided tour of "Mr. Charlie", an authentic drilling rig. It's the only place in the world where the general public can walk aboard an authentic offshore drilling rig.
